The biggest issue with the Heavy Darklight is the only crafted alternative is Heavy Darksteel, which also can't be split into helm/chest and pants/boots. This really screws over tanks that are trying to break their HDL with Myth/Allagan gear, whereas every other class can replace the non i90 slot with an i70 crafted item.

Why oh why did they make Darklight and Heavy Darksteel both locked? It's so great to get the Allagan Chest, your first piece of Allagan from turn one, and you have to go back to Hoplite because there are no other helms to pick from since both ilevel 70 options are locked.
If you have the Allagan chest, then you have a few options, all of them would still be better than darklight.Why oh why did they make Darklight and Heavy Darksteel both locked? It's so great to get the Allagan Chest, your first piece of Allagan from turn one, and you have to go back to Hoplite because there are no other helms to pick from since both ilevel 70 options are locked.
1. You can use the AF head piece (it is still actually better when combined with the Allagan top, stats and defense wise).
2. If you have the Mythology points you can go and get the Valor head piece, it is actually slightly better than the Allagan as it has more accuracy. (You swap crit for Parry with the allagan head). Otherwise they are identical stat wise.
3. You can farm up an AK Hoplight Circlet which is a good inbetween piece between the AF and Allagan.
In the end you have better stats than the Darklight hands down and you can show your face/hair. Win Win if you ask me.
The Darklight and Darksteel is just meant to be an Interrum piece and may soon be replaced with Crystal Tower.
This Darklight and Darksteel set has been around since early 1.0 do I would not expect they would prioritize changing/ redesigning this armor that will just get replaced with just about anything new.
